FanLinc Won't Shut Off Fan


brockp

Recommended Posts

I have a FanLinc, been installed for about 4 months.  Last night I was warm and tried to speed up the fan but it jumped to full speed.

 

I went into MobiLinc and tried to control it and while it would report and respond off, low, med, etc.  it stayed full speed.  I tried from the ISY console same issue, the log says value are being changed but stays full speed.

 

I then shut off power at the breaker waiting a minute, turned back on same issue.

 

Light portion still work fine,  just the fan control appears to have failed.

 

I have not done a factory rest on it yet, as it's in the attic and have to climb up to get it. Though with the way it behaves I'm not sure it will help.

 

Anyone else had issues with this?  The device is almost new.

 

Thoughts?

Communication problem? Corrupt links? From the ISY, are you controlling a scene or fanlinc from ISY?

 

I would try some simpler things first, before climbing to attic. Try a restore device on the fanlinc. Try moving plm to different circuit. Try query the fanlinc (does it respond?).

 

Hopefully a full reset is not needed.

No communication problem, I and query it just fine. I see the ack's in the ISY log.  It reports the correct settings.

 

I'm controlling everything via scenes, but went into the device directly also, same behavior.

 

Light control works just fine also, so not thinking communication problem.

 

I also did a restore from they ISY that worked just fine, no change in behavior.
